How much do remote order processing j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 24,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ote order processing in Midvale, UT is $17.27,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.76 and $19.04 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a typical day look like for someone working in Remote Order Processing?

A typical day in Remote Order Processing involves reviewing and entering customer orders into order management systems, verifying details for accuracy, and resolving any discrepancies through communication with customers or internal teams. You may also be responsible for updating order statuses, coordinating with warehouse or shipping departments, and addressing order-related inquiries via email or phone. While the work is generally independent, collaboration with sales, logistics, and customer service teams is common. Effective multitasking and time management are key, as you’ll often juggle several orders or requests at once. This role suits those who enjoy structured responsibilities and direct impact on customer satisfaction.

What is a Remote Order Processing job?

A Remote Order Processing job involves handling customer orders from a remote location. Responsibilities may include entering orders into a system, verifying order details, processing payments, and ensuring timely fulfillment. This role often requires strong attention to detail, good communication skills, and familiarity with order management software. Many businesses, such as e-commerce companies and retail suppliers, hire remote order processors to streamline operations. It is a crucial role that helps ensure customer satisfaction and efficient order fulfillment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Remote Order Processing position, and why are they important?

To thrive in Remote Order Processing, strong attention to detail, organizational skills, and experience with order management or data entry are essential,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Proficiency with common order processing platforms (such as SAP, Oracle, or Shopify), CRM tools, and basic spreadsheet software is typically required. Excellent communication skills, problem-solving ability, and reliability help set candidates apart in this remote environment. These skills and qualities ensure accurate, efficient order fulfillment, customer satisfaction, and seamless collaboration with internal teams.
